Устройство для контроля цифровых блоков

Иллюстрации

Показать все

Реферат

 

УСТРОЙСТВО ДЛЯ КОНТРОЛЯ ЦИФРОВЫХ БЛОКОВ, содержащее эталонный блок, m элементов сравнения, дешифратор, регистр, причем группа информационных входов проверяемого и эталонного блоков является группой информационных входов устройства; m выходов проверяемого блока и первый выход эталонного блока подключены соответственно к первым и вторым входам m элементов сравнения, отличающееся тем, что, с целью его упрощения, в устройство введены первая группа из «.элементов И, вторая группа из Ч элементов и (е 3 ео hiQ ) , два счетчика, триггер, первый и второй элементы задержки , первый, второй и третий элементы И, первый и второй элементы ИЛИ, причем выходы гп элементов срат нения соединены с первыми входами соответствующих m элементов И первой группы, вторые входы которых связаны с соответствующими m выходамк . дешифратора и т выходами эталонного блока, выходов дешифратора подключены соответственно к Е выходам., первого счетчика и к первым входам I элементов И второй группы, вторые входы которых связа ны; , с выходом первого элемента И, первый и второй входы которого соединены соответственно с единичным выходом триггера и выходом первого элемента ИЛИ, нулевой выход триггера соединен с первыми входами второго и третьего элементов И, второй вход второго элемента И подключен к выходу .торого счетчи-. ка и входу второго элемента задержки , выход которого соединен с управляющим входом регистра и первым входом второго элемента ИЛИ, i второй вход которого является входом сброса устройства и подключен (О С к входам сброса второго счетчика и регистра, выходы регистра являются выходами устройства, выход второго элемента ИЛИ соединен с нулевым входом.триггера, единичный вход которого подключен к выходу первого элемента задержки, вход которого связан с вторым входом третьего элемента И, выход которого соединен с информационным входом второго счетчика, выходы t элементов И второй группы связаны с информационными вхо;.ами регистра (t +1)-й вход которого подключен к .выходу второго элемента И, вы- |. ходы m элементов И первой группы i соединены с соответствующими входами первого элемента ИЛИ, тактовый вход ; устройства связан с входом п.ервого счетчика.

СОЮЗ СОВЕТСНИХ

СОЦИАЛИСТИЧЕСНИХ

РЕСПУБЛИН (19) (11) 3(5D

ГОСУДАРСТВЕННЫЙ НОМИТЕТ СССР

П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ТКРЫТИЙ

ОПИСАНИЕ ИЗОБРЕ

Н АВТОРСКОМУ СВИДЕТЕЛЬСТВУ (21) 3633244/24-24 (22) 09. 08. 83 (46) 07.12.84. Бюл.Р 45 (72) Н.Ф. Окулович, Л, Б. Авгуль, С.Н.Макареня и В.A.Ìèùåíêo . (53) 681.326(088.8) (56) 1.Авторское свидетельство СССР

9 G F 15/46, 1981.

2. Авторское свидетельство СССР

9 706849 кл. G 06 F 15/46, 1979 (IIOOTOTHII) . (54)(57) УСТРОЙСТВО ДЛЯ КОНТРОЛЯ

ЦИФРОВЫХ БЛОКОВ, содержащее эталонный блок, m элементов сравнения, дешифратор, регистр, причем группа информационных входов проверяемого и эталонного блоков является группой информационных входов устройства; выходов проверяемого блока и первый выход эталонного блока подключены соответственно к первым и вторым входам а элементов сравнения, о т л и ч а ю щ е е с я тем, что, с целью его упрощения, в устройство введены первая группа из элементов И., вторая группа из P. эле- ментов И ((=) Ео ь (), два счетчика, триггер, первый и второй элементы задержки, первый,.второй и третий элементы И, первый и второй элементы ИЛИ, причем выходы ш элементов сра-:нения соединены с первыми входами соответствующих ю элементов И первой группы, вторые входы которых связаны с соответству;зщими т выходами. дешифратора и m выходами эталонного блока, 1 выходов дешифратора подключены соответственно к выходам.. первого счетчика и к первым входам 6 элементов И второй группы, вторые входы которых связаны;, с выходом первого элемента И, первый и второй входы которого соединены соответственно с единичным выходом триггера и выходом первогo элемента ИЛИ, нулевой выход триггера соединен с первыми входами второго и третьего элементов

И, второй вход второго элемента И подключен к выходу,второго счетчи-, ка и входу второго элемента за.держки, выход которого соединен с управляющим входом регистра и первым входом второго элемента ИЛИ, второй вход которого является входом сброса устройства и подключен к входам сброса второго счетчика и .регистра, выходы регистра являются выходами устройства, выход второго элемента ИЛИ соединен с нуле" вым входом, триггера, единичный вход которого подключен к выходу первого элемента задержки, вход которого связан с вторым входом третьего элемента И, выход которого соединен с информационным входом второго счетчика, выходы 1 эле« ментов И второй группы связаны с информационньМи входами регистра (1 +1)-й вход которого подключен к выходу второго элемента И, выходы m элементов И первой группы соединены с соответствующими входами первого элемента ИЛИ, тактовый вход устройства связан с входом первого счетчика.

1128267 fO

Изобретение относится к области автоматического диагностирования радиоэлектронной аппаратуры и может быть использовано в системах диагностирования иэделий, а также в ЭВМ для проверками функционирования уст- 5 ройств в проце"се их работы.

Известно устройство для проверки функционирования БИС, содержащее блок программного управления, блок синхронизации, блок формирования, регистры сдвига, элементы И, блок памяти, регистры адреса, регистр цик." лов, регистр тактов, регистр синхронизации 13.

Недостатком данного устройства является значительная сложность, что ограничивает его воэможности по использованию в ЭВМ для проверки функционирования узлов в процессе их работы.

Наиболее близким к изобретению по технической сущности является устройство для проверки функционирования многовыходных цифровых узлов, содержащее генератор тестов, эталонный и проверяемый блоки, блок управления, блоки сравнения, блок пирамидальной свертки по модулю два, сумматор, регистр сдвига, дешифратор исправности, дешифратор неисправности и индикатор исправности(23. 30

Недостатками известного устройства являются большая сложность и ограниченные возможности по использо.ванию его в 3ВМ для проверки функционирования блоков- в процессе работы, 35 так как входными воздействиями для проверяемого блока являются сигналы генератора тестов.

Цель — упрощение. устройства.

Поставленная цель достигается тем,4() что в устройство для контроля цифровых блоков, содержащее эталонный блок,tn элементов сравнения, дешифратор, регистр, причем группа информационных входов проверяемого и 45 эталонного блоков является группой информационных в .одов устройства, ю выходов проверяемого блока и первый выход эталонного блока подключены соответственно к первым и вторым входам rn элементов сравнения, введены первая группа из m.элементов И, вторая группа из Р элементов И (Р=(Ро 2 г ), два счетчика, триггер, первый и второй элементы задержки, первый, второй и третий элементы И, .первый и второй элементы HJlH, причем. выходы m элементов сравнения соединены с первыми входами соответствующих т элементов И первой группы, вто-. рые входы котовых связаны с соответст- 60 вующими т выходами дешифратора и выходами эталонного блока, выходов дешифратора подключены соответственно к Р выходам первого счетчика и к первым входам Р эле - 65 ментов И второй группы, вторые. входы которых связаны с выходом первого элемента И, первый и второй входы которого соединены соответственно с единичным выходом триггера и выходом первого элемента ИЛИ, нулевой выход триггера соединен с.первыми входами второго и третьего элементов И, второй вход второго элемента И подключен к вы- ходу второго счетчика и входу второго элемента задержки, выход которого соединен с управляющим входом регистра и первым входом второго элемента ИЛИ, второй вход которого является входом сброса устройства и подключен к входам сброса второго счетчика и регистра, выходы регистра являются выходами устройства, выход второго элемента ИЛИ соединен с нулевым входом триггера, единичный вход которого подключен к выходу первого элемента задержки, вход котррого связан с вторым входом третьего элемента И, выход которого соединен с информационным входом второго счетчика, выходы элементов И второй группы связаны с

Р информационными входами регистра (Р+1)-й вход которого подключен к выходу второго элемента И, выходы в элементов И первой группы соединены с соответствующими входами перного элемента ИЛИ, тактовый вход устройства связан с входом первого счетчика.

На чертеже представлена функциОнальная схема предлагаемого устройства.

Устройство содержит проверяемый блок 1, эталонный блок 2, счетчики

3 и 4, дешифратор 5, регистр б, элементов 7 сравнения, первую группу из m элементов H 8, вторую группу из Р элементов И 9 (Р=1Ро ь С ) элементы И 10-1.2, элементы ИЛЙ 13 и

14, триггер 15 и элементы 16 и 17 задержки.

Многофункциональный эталонный блок 2 реализует последовательно на одном выходе функции каждого выхода проверяемого блока. В простейшем случае многофункциональный эталонный блок может быть выполнен -на основе проверяемого блока с последовательным подключением его выходов на один общий выход.

Устройство работает следующим образом.

На счетчике 3, число разрядов которого Р=) о mP вырабатывается код номера i-ro выхода проверяемого блоха 1, .который поступает на дешиф ратор 5. По сигналам дешифратора эталонный блок 2 реализует функцию

i-ro выхода проверяемого блока, с которой сравнивается проверяемая функция..4

1128267

Если значения функций проверяемо- детельствует о неисправности эталонго и эталонного блоков равны, то на ного блока, а с нулем в (3+1)-ом выходе элемента ИЛИ 13 будет нулевой, разряде - о неисправности проверяемосигнал и на вход регистра 6 не посту- го блока, при этом код номера выхода, пит информация, так как на вторые. на котором реализуется неправильная входы элементов И 9 и 11 поступает 5 функция, содержится в разрядах. нулевой потенциал. Емкость Счетчика 4 выбирается та»

С поступлением следующего такто- кой, чтобы она была больше числа вывого импульса проверяется на сонпа- ходов проверяемого блока, на которых дение функция (> +1)-ro выхода. требуется обнаружить неправильное

В случае несовпадения функций fo функционирование, и меньше общего сигнал несравнения с выхода .элемента числа выходов проверяемого блока.

ИЛИ 13 пройдет через элемент И 10: на С целью увеличения быстродействия первые входы элементов И 9, так как целесообразно емкость счетчика выбитриггер 15 в исходном состоянии раз- рать близкой к нижней границе. решает прохождение сигнала через 5 При исправном эталонном блоке этот элемент. схема устройства позволяет последоВ результате в регистр 6 запишет- вательно обнаружить неправильное. ся код номера выхода проверяемого функционирование по нескольким выхоблока, по которому произошло несрав- дам проверяемого блока. Число этих нение функций. выходов зависит от емкости счетчика

Через элемент 16 задержки сигнал 4, поэтому последняя выбирается в несравнения переведет триггер 15 в зависимости от требования, которое состояние, при котором разрешающий является предпочтительным. В общем потенциал с его второго выхода посту- случае она может быть выбрана по пит на элемент И 12. формуле С= в+в, где rn -число выхоЕсли окажется неисправным эталон- ..-.= 2 ный блок, то за несколько тактов дов проверяемого блока, на которых сравнения функций по различным выхо-,требуется обнаружить неправильное дам импульсы несравнения пройдут через функционирование. элемент И 12 на вход счетчика 4, Предлагаемое устройство в отлиимпульс переполнения которого через ЗО чие от известных не содержит сдвиэлемент И 11 запишет единицу в гающий регистр, сумматор, блок (1 +1)-й разряд регистра 6,, а через . свертки по модулю два, генератор элемент 17 задержки осуществит выда-,тестов, а разрядность используемых чу кода с регистра и установку триг- . в нем двоичных счетчиков невелика, гера 15 в исходное состояние, в ко- 35 поэтому оно имеет меньшую сложность. торое он может быть также переведен Кроме ;ого, отсутствие генератора совместно с счетчиком 4 и регистром тестов расширяет его возможности

6 импульсом установки исходного coc= по использованию в эВм, так как тояния, подаваемым .на вход сброса позволяет осуществлять проверку устройства.. Kore. выдаваемый с регист-4О функционирования цифровых блоков ра с единицей в (8 +1) -ом разряде,сви- в процессе их работы.

1128267

Составитель И.Сафронова

Техред Л.Коцюбняк Корректор М.Максимишинец

Редактор A.Ãðàòèëëo

Ваказ 9063/37 Тираж 698

ВНИИПИ Государственного комитета СССР по делам изобретений и открытий

113035, Москва, Ж-35, Раушская наб., д.4/5

Подписное

Фнлиал ППП Патент, r.Óæãoðoä, ул.Проектная, 4